Net Price by Family Income
What families actually pay after grants and scholarships:
| $0 - $30,000 | $6,517 |
| $30,001 - $48,000 | $6,155 |
| $48,001 - $75,000 | $8,721 |
| $75,001 - $110,000 | $11,667 |
| $110,001+ | $13,380 |
